What’s In Her Genes  "by Artie Dean Harris"

This song is a fun, up tempo attention getter, creatively written around the play on the words "genes" and "jeans". Listen closely to the lyrics, don't let them fool you.

This song developed from a television interview. A race car driver was asked the question, "What makes you such a talented driver"? He replied "I come from a family history of successful drivers. I guess it's in my genes". I thought... what a cool way for Wrangler or any jeans company to advertise their product. Then it hit me...what about a song..."It's In My Genes"...no what about..."What's In My Genes"...no "What's In Her Genes"...Yeah! That's it! This will be fun I said. Once I had the title, the concept and the story was easy. Two hours later I had completed the song.

There was a period of time when my car had no radio. This was great because I was forced to entertain myself. I would sing away at the wheel, particularly on the long stretch to my girlfriend's house. The day I wrote this song, I arrived at her house and asked what she had been doing that day. Of course she had been shopping and because I had been writing on the way to her house, I jokingly said, "I'm going to write a song about you shopping." And then the light went off. It's amazing how a simple joke can be created into a great song when you are in that creative zone. I thought to myself right then...what a great idea, a girl that's shopping not for clothes but for a guy. So I began to write down as many words that I could think of related to shopping: bargain, midnight madness, perfect fit, display, etc. and that night on the twenty minute drive home "One Hell Of A Deal" was completed thanks to my creativity and Jennifer Ann's love for shopping.

This is my favorite story to tell about writing a song. I was in the drive through line at the bank four cars away from the window. All of a sudden the idea that many liquors had guys names popped into my head. I began to ramble off as many as I could think off. Jim, Jack & José made the cut. By the time I pulled up to the window, I had the entire song completed on the back of my deposit slip. Jim, Jack, &José has now become the crowd favorite.
